At 4 o’clock Saturday afternoon, August 15 Rev. Dr. Walter Brueggemann will give a presentation in the sanctuary of Laurel Heights United Methodist Church to consider evidence in the Bible that ancient faith lives in the midst of an economy of extraction, an arrangement that extracts wealth and labor from the vulnerable to reassign it to the powerful who dominate society. Biblical faith, in both the Old and New Testaments, commends and practices an alternative economy of restoration that intends to restore well-being those who have had their produce forcibly extracted from them. The radical witness of the Bible amounts to the practice of an alternative to those ancient economies of greed. Clearly it does not take much imagination to see how the same dynamics are at work among us concerning extraction and restoration. For Sunday’s sermon at both the 8:30 and 11 o’clock services, Dr. Brueggemann will use Psalm 111 and the gospel reading from John 6. In addition to Psalm 111, he will appeal to Psalm 112, its partner.
